VCLS Demo 2 Mission One

Overview

Destination: Low Earth Orbit
Mission: Technology

Low Earth Orbit Unknown Pad Cape Canaveral SFS, FL, USA

Payload consists of a single 30 kg NASA payload to be delivered to a 500 km orbit with a 41 degrees inclination.

Updates

Cosmic_Penguin • April 12, 2023, 4:01 p.m.

Launch vehicle choice now uncertain with Relativity Space planning to retire Terran-1 immediately; may switch to Terran-R but launch would then be NET 2026.
